XFRM - Создание более 1 загрузки на внешний URL

Sadorimatsu

Проверенные
Сообщения
418
Решения
13
Реакции
228
Баллы
345
Всем привет.

Ищу исполнителя на возможность создания плагина для расширения возможностей загрузки внешних URL в XFRM на XF 2.2.12+.
Подробно об этом писал тут - https://xenforo.info/threads/xfrm-Множество-внешних-url.56822/

Цена вопроса? Возможности реализации? Потому что на офе об этом ни слова и делать явно не планируют, по обновке 2.3 судя по всему тоже ничего меняться не будет.

Внешние URL, возможно можно будет выводить через создание доп. полей макроса, что я вижу возможным, но как это выводить уже под расширение загрузки внешних URL остается вопросом. Либо нужно создать скрипт для добавление нужных нам строк, либо создаем доп. поля фиксировано через доп. поле ресурсов и тогда при создании или обновлении ресурса вид строк будет больше, но делать портянку тоже не хочется, тут надо подумать, как лучше обыграть. Иных технических вариантов не вижу. Может у кого-то будут идеи?
Задача 1.png
Хотелось бы такого же принципа при нажатии скачать, как ниже, но для внешних URL: (Или похоже, неважно:) )
Задача 2.png
И конечно важно, когда мы редактируем ресурс, то мы видим внешний URL, который указываем для скачивания, тем самым тот же принцип оставить для всех загруженных ссылок, чтобы мы их видели так же при редактировании ресурса. Остается вопрос решить по лимиту загрузки таких ссылок.
 
Последнее редактирование:
Кстати, на IPS ведь есть поддержка загрузки нескольких ссылок, странно, что на XF никому нет дела до этого.
Вот например покажу как у них это реализовано:
image.png
 
Последнее редактирование:
Разработка плагина закончена. Результатом более чем доволен. Не мало правда было исправлений, как и учёт защиты от дурака. Кому нужен плагин, то обращайтесь к BergStudio, я не против его распространения т.к. вещь жизненно необходима для определенных задач. Свою цену заказ оправдал. По всем вопросам плагина, обращайтесь к нему, возможно скоро сам выложит.
BergStudio отдельная благодарность за работу.

Что было реализовано?
  • Лимит использование внешних URL на уровне групп. Можно регулировать, какая группа сколько сможет использовать внешних URL.
  • Выводит множества внешних URL через модальное окно. Тот же принцип, как с файлами.
  • При добавлении внешних URL добавлена возможность указать Заголовок и Описание к каждому URL.
  • При добавлении внешних URL, если не заполнять Заголовок и Описание, то заголовок URL будет по умолчанию выводится согласно порядковому номеру. Текст забит во фразах.
  • Заголовок цепляется к названию URL. Заполняется Заголовок и Описание по желанию.
  • Защита от дурака учтена, если URL не добавили, а Заголовок или Описание были заполнены, то при сохранении это поле будет удалено.
  • Сохранение внешних URL в черновике.

Тему можно закрывать.
 
Последнее редактирование:
Решил наглядно показать, как это выглядит на живом примере. При создании доступен вид на 1 поле, при заполнении добавляется 2, если не нужно, то не заполняется и сохраняется заполненное. На скринах примеры оформления и без оформления URL. Как и выглядит в итоговом виде и как при обновлении. При редактировании аналогично, как при создании.
 

Вложения

  • Screen Shot 07-09-24 at 04.30 PM.PNG
    Screen Shot 07-09-24 at 04.30 PM.PNG
    9 KB · Просмотры: 29
  • Screen Shot 07-09-24 at 04.31 PM.PNG
    Screen Shot 07-09-24 at 04.31 PM.PNG
    17.7 KB · Просмотры: 25
  • Screen Shot 07-09-24 at 04.22 PM.PNG
    Screen Shot 07-09-24 at 04.22 PM.PNG
    424 KB · Просмотры: 24
  • Screen Shot 07-09-24 at 04.24 PM.PNG
    Screen Shot 07-09-24 at 04.24 PM.PNG
    35.9 KB · Просмотры: 24
  • Screen Shot 07-09-24 at 04.32 PM.PNG
    Screen Shot 07-09-24 at 04.32 PM.PNG
    52.7 KB · Просмотры: 29
Последнее редактирование:
Современный облачный хостинг провайдер | Aéza
Назад
Сверху Снизу